Valeria Marquez: TikTok beauty influencer shot dead during live stream at beauty salon in Zapopan, Mexico

Beauty influencer Valeria Marquez was speaking with followers on a TikTok live stream on Tuesday when she was shot dead.

The shocking moment was seen by some of Marquez’s near 200,000 followers who are now calling for justice over the beauty influencer’s brutal slaying.

Marquez was sitting in the beauty salon where she worked in the city of Zapopan, when a man entered and shot her, a statement from the prosecutor’s office said.

The office did not name a suspect.

Seconds before the incident, Marquez was seen on her TikTok livestream seated at a table clutching a stuffed toy. She was heard saying, “they’re coming,” before a voice in the background asked “Hey, Vale?

“Yes,” Marquez replied, just before muting the sound on the livestream.

Moments later, she was shot to death. A person appeared to pick up her phone, with their face briefly showing on the livestream before the video ended.

The death of Marquez, 23, is being investigated according to protocols for femicide – the killing of women or girls for reasons of gender – the Jalisco state prosecutor said in a statement released on Tuesday evening.

Marquez had said earlier on the live stream that someone came to the salon when she was not there with an “expensive gift” to deliver to her. Marquez, who appeared concerned, said she was not planning to wait for the person to come back.

Mexico is tied with Paraguay, Uruguay and Bolivia as the countries with the fourth-highest rates of femicide in Latin America and the Caribbean, according to the latest data from the United Nations Economic Commission for Latin America and the Caribbean, at 1.3 such deaths for every 100,000 women in 2023.

Jalisco is ranked sixth out of Mexico’s 32 states, including Mexico City, for homicides, with 906 recorded there since the beginning of President Claudia Sheinbaum’s term in October 2024, according to data consultancy TResearch.
